What Does a Car Locksmith Do?
Car locksmith professionals focus on vehicle-related locks and keys. Their services include a broad variety of jobs, including:

Finding a budget friendly car locksmith who provides quality service needs some due diligence. Here are some actions you can take:
Research Local Locksmiths: Use online platforms and local directories to identify locksmiths in your location. Try to find those who focus on [Automotive Locksmith UK](https://twistorder23.bravejournal.net/sage-advice-about-best-car-locksmith-from-an-older-five-year-old) services.
Read Reviews: Check consumer evaluations on sites like Google, Yelp, or Angie's List. Favorable feedback can indicate reputable service.
Ask for Recommendations: Consult pals or family who have utilized car locksmith services just recently.
Compare Pricing: Contact numerous locksmiths to get quotes. Ensure you understand any additional fees, such as emergency services or after-hours charges.
Verify Credentials: Ensure the locksmith is licensed, guaranteed, and has good standing with the Better Business Bureau (BBB).
Ask about Warranty: Good locksmith professionals often provide a warranty on their services, providing comfort.

How do I prevent getting locked out of my car?
To avoid being locked out, always keep a spare secret in a recognized safe location or consider using a keyless entry system. Regularly check to ensure your keys are in your ownership before leaving the car.
2. How do I understand if a locksmith is genuine?
Examine for credentials such as a service license, insurance, and favorable consumer reviews. A reliable locksmith will likewise supply a written estimate before beginning any work.
3. What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?
Remain calm, look for a spare secret, or call a reputable locksmith for help. Prevent attempting to open the door yourself to prevent damage.
4. The length of time does it typically take a locksmith to unlock a car?
The time it takes can differ depending on the lock type and the locksmith's experience. Generally, it can take between 15 and 30 minutes.
5. Are there any special locks that need various services?
Yes, contemporary vehicles frequently include complicated security systems, including deadbolts and electronic locks, which may need specific tools and training to unlock.
